Modern Windows for Today's Business

Microsoft has therefore come up with a technology that we all know and is available from any device. Windows 365 securely streams the entire Windows environment, including apps, data, and settings, to your personal or corporate devices. This revolutionary approach is changing established ways of working and creating the perfect environment for modern business.

Windows 365 is available in two versions – Enterprise and Business. The Enterprise version is designed for large corporations with hundreds of employees. It is more complex, allows for greater customization, but its setup requires deeper technical knowledge or IT specialists. Conversely, Windows 365 Business is designed for individuals, small and medium-sized businesses. What do they offer you?

Virtual computer anywhere and from anywhere

As we've already mentioned, Windows 365 displays a personalized desktop, applications, settings, and content from the cloud to any device. In practice, this gives you a virtualized computer environment that you can access from any brand of device or operating system. You can easily open your desired Microsoft 365 application in your web browser window and expand the window to full screen. Pick up where you left off – anytime, anywhere, and on any device.

Quick system transition and easy management

The Windows 365 hybrid system is simple to set up and deploy. You can get the Business version up and running in your company within 30 minutes. Conveniently, without technical skills or IT specialists, employees can handle the installation themselves. They can then start working on the platform quickly and effortlessly. Furthermore, the virtual desktop saves costs on IT management and time. This allows you to fully concentrate on your team and business. 

Simple operation without expertise

The entire new cloud system, as well as all its components, can be managed in the Microsoft Endpoint Manager application, or you can open the address in your web browser at windows365.microsoft.com And you can start working immediately. Windows 365 is a complete “software as a service” solution. Microsoft developed it to be as easy to control and use as possible. Therefore, you do not need any specialized knowledge.

Always secure work and data evidence

Windows 365 utilizes verified and trusted security features. The manufacturer guarantees perfect security by leveraging cloud power and Zero Trust principles. Within the Microsoft Endpoint Manager user interface in a web browser, you can easily manage and secure all endpoints, both physical and virtual. Furthermore, modern data protection mitigates data leaks – you track and secure information directly in the cloud rather than on individual physical devices, significantly reducing security risks.

A meal exactly according to your needs and requirements

A modern system for your business is within reach. Choose the Business or Enterprise version and one of the basic packages – Basic (€28.20), Standard (€37.30), or Premium (€60.10). Personalized packages, tailored to your requirements, are also available.

Microsoft Corporation

Pricing is always paid monthly per user, so you have your costs under control without any unexpected surprises. Furthermore, Microsoft regularly monitors the performance of individual cloud computers and can recommend an upgrade option in real-time.
